The South Africa vs New Zealand 4th Test live streams will showcase a deciding match in the Rugby's Greatest Rivalry series. The Springboks emerged as winners from another fiercely contested clash in Johannesburg last Saturday to take a 2-1 lead, so they will be aiming to clinch overall victory.
Rassie Erasmus' side fought back to triumph 29-24 in a pulsating 3rd Test, as they overpowered New Zealand in the second half. That gave the Springboks an unofficial series victory across the three matches played in South Africa, but there remains plenty to play for as the teams cross the Atlantic ahead of the finale at Baltimore's 71,000-capacity M&T Bank Stadium.
The two-time reigning world champions will be without star back Cheslin Kolbe after he suffered a broken jaw in Johannesburg, with fit-again Damian Willemse replacing the full-back. Morne van den Berg gets a start at scrum-half, with Cobus Reinach swapping to bench.
New Zealand led 17-12 in the second half as they eyed just their second series win in South Africa, and their first since 1996, but they must now pick themselves up as they bid to level the series at 2-2. The All Blacks must do it without captain Ardie Savea following the captain's dislocated shoulder in the 3d Test, while Quinn Tupaea and Luke Jacobson, who finished last weekend's game as skipper, miss out due to knee and elbow injuries respectively. Meanwhile, Fabian Holland is absent through illness.
Head coach Dave Rennie has made eight changes to his XV, including an all-new front row. Hooker Codie Taylor returns to captain New Zealand, while Ethan de Groot and Fletcher Newell also start. The latter is one of five players making their first Test starts of the series, along with lock Patrick Tuipulotu, back-row Ethan Blackadder, fly-half Richie Mo'unga and centre Anton Lienert-Brown. Josh Moorby is also back in the XV. This is the teams' first-ever meeting on US soil, the Boks having recovered from their 1st Test defeat to take the advantage heading into the decider.
